description abstract | To back analyze the smear effect and well resistance of a ground that incorporates prefabricated vertical drains, a simple method based on the hyperbolic method previously reported and a simplified form of the consolidation solutions were developed. The method was applied to a well-documented case study. The result indicated that the mobilized discharge capacity of the drain obtained by using the theoretically possible ranges of some of main unknown factors considerably agreed with the measured result. | |
